===Syntactic pivots===
Syntactic pivots arise in a natural way from the split-ergative morphosyntax.
Syntactic pivoting arises in a natural way from the split-ergative morphosyntax: to wit, if clause A is in an ''accusative tense'' (present, imperfect, or future, in any mood), a following clause B in an ''ergative tense'' (preterite in any mood) may take the subject of clause A as its own patient argument without explicitly stating it.
